The Ellen Greenberg Case: When Forensic Science Says Murder but the City Says Suicide
When a young teacher was found dead with 20 stab wounds, ten of them in the back of her neck, Philadelphia officials called it suicide. Her family has spent 14 years trying to prove that's physically impossible. Now, after a court-ordered review just discovered 20 more bruises and three additional stab wounds that were never documented, the city still insists she killed herself. We're breaking down the biomechanical evidence, the flip-flopping medical examiner, the contradictions in the crime scene, and why this case feels less like an investigation and more like a cover-up. This is the story of Ellen Greenberg, and the justice system that failed her.
